Product Manager is one of the hottest positions in the emerging digital economy. The Product Manager is essentially the “CEO” of a digital product. They understand and articulate needs; set up roadmaps, plan and coordinate the development process; champion and launch products and oversee the product life cycle. They are the implementers of ideas in digital business innovation.

What’s a MicroMasters® program?
A MicroMasters® program is a series of higher-level courses derived from Universities master’s programs and endorsed by companies for relevant job advancement and deeper learning in a specific subject area. Students verifying, completing, and passing all courses in a MicroMasters® program receive an edX MicroMasters® program credential, which can count towards Master’s degree credit if the learner applies to the university offering the credential and is accepted.
MicroMasters® program offerings allow learners to demonstrate capacity and mastery of material for a given career area, and enable edX partners to showcase the educational offerings of their institutions as well as viewing the capabilities and drive of potential student applicants to on-campus programs.
